Diff for /loncom/interface/loncreateuser.pm between versions 1.160 and 1.161

version 1.160, 2007/07/28 21:38:29 version 1.161, 2007/07/29 04:32:44
Line 762  ENDFORMINFO Line 762  ENDFORMINFO
         }          }
     }      }
     if ($uhome eq 'no_host') {      if ($uhome eq 'no_host') {
         my $instsrch = {           my $newuser;
           my $instsrch = {
                          srchin => 'instd',                           srchin => 'instd',
                          srchterm => $env{'form.seluname'},  
                          srchdomain => $env{'form.seludom'},  
                          srchby => 'uname',                           srchby => 'uname',
                          srchtype => 'exact',                           srchtype => 'exact',
                        };                         };
         my %inst_results;          if ((exists($env{'form.seluname'})) && (exists($env{'form.seludom'}))) {
         if (directorysrch_check($instsrch) eq 'ok') {              $instsrch->{'srchterm'} = $env{'form.seluname'};
             %inst_results = &Apache::lonnet::inst_directory_query($instsrch);              $instsrch->{'srchdomain'} = $env{'form.seludom'};
           } else {
               $instsrch->{'srchterm'} = $env{'form.srchterm'};
               $instsrch->{'srchdomain'} = $env{'form.srchdomain'},
           }
           if (($instsrch->{'srchterm'} ne '') && ($instsrch->{'srchdomain'} ne '')) {
               $newuser = $instsrch->{'srchterm'}.':'.$instsrch->{'srchdomain'};
           }
           my (%dirsrch_results,%inst_results);
           if ($newuser) {
               if (&directorysrch_check($instsrch) eq 'ok') {
                   %dirsrch_results = &Apache::lonnet::inst_directory_query($instsrch);
                   if (ref($dirsrch_results{$newuser}) eq 'HASH') { 
                       %inst_results = %{$dirsrch_results{$newuser}};
                   } 
               }
         }          }
         my $home_server_list=          my $home_server_list=
             '<option value="default" selected>default</option>'."\n".              '<option value="default" selected>default</option>'."\n".

Removed from v.1.160  
changed lines
  Added in v.1.161


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>